Context
Some apps need the ability to parse token from url. A usecase would be to implement reset password links.
What problem are you trying to solve?
Allow the plugin to read token from url search query param. Something like
https://api.test.com?token=sdfsdfsdfsf
would be read and parsedImplementing this opens up the plugin to a wide variety of usecases, like email reset password links, token based file access etc
Do you have a new or modified API suggestion to solve the problem?
Yes, this can be done similar to what we did with cookieName
